Instead serving chocolate cake as is, decorate it simple way, with strawberry slices!

Step 1: Coring Strawberries

You can use knife obviously, but by using a firm straw, the hole would be the same size for each strawberry.

Just remove the leaves and/or stems and push in your straw, voila

Halved, then slice each halves thinly as shown on the last picture.

Step 2: Chocolate Cake

This is a chocolate cake that I learned while living in Hungary. Many variety of chocolate cakes of course, and you can use your own favorite chocolate cake!

Csokoladetorta (cake)

100 g chocolate (milk)

100 g butter (dont substitute)

160 g icing sugar

7 eggs

150 flour

Melt chocolate and let it cool to room temperature

Beat butter and icing sugar then add in yolk one at a time

Once all yolks is added in, pour in melted chocolate and beat for 20 minutes

In another bowl, beat egg whites until stiff then fold in flour a little at a time, folding it lightly

Mix the yolk mixture and white mixture, folding lightly

Pour batter into 2 9 inch round pan and bake at 350 F for 30 minutes or until knife inserted in center comes out clean (please do watch out for your oven temperature. each oven has differ temperature and sometimes the accuracy is not reliable unless you have oven temperature measurement)

Cool on rack

Chocolate Glaze

3 eggs

210 g icing sugar

150 g butter

50 g chocolate

Crack the eggs into a bowl and add in icing sugar.

Over steam (double boiler), mix them until thickened

Melt chocolate and butter then add into lukewarm eggs

Keep stirring until cool to room temperature

Final Cake

Stack the cakes and between layers spread some peach jam. Once stack, pour chocolate glaze from top and covering side as well

You can decorate with strawberry slices right away or wait a bit until glaze is firming on cake (so strawberry wont slide down)

Slice and enjoy~
